The Gulfstream G650, flagship ultra-long-range business jet that redefined luxury aviation, first flew on November 25, 2009. This clean-sheet design featured a swept wing, twin Rolls-Royce BR725 turbofans mounted on the rear fuselage, and accommodated 14-19 passengers in executive configuration. Capable of Mach 0.925 maximum speed with over 7,000 nautical miles range, the G650 was manufactured by Gulfstream Aerospace Corporation in Savannah, Georgia.
